Title: Plank-Smoked Peaches & Goat Cheese
Categories: Fruits, Cheese, Nuts, Herbs, Breads
Yield: 8 Servings
4 oz Goat cheese (chevre)
1 ts Snipped fresh basil
1/2 ts Snipped fresh thyme
1/2 ts Snipped fresh chives
1/4 ts Ground black pepper
1 ts Olive oil
2 md Peaches; halved, pitted *
1/3 c Walnut or pecan halves;
- coarsely broken
1 tb Honey
Crackers or toasted baguette
-style French bread
- slices
EQUIPMENT: A 14" x 6" x 3/4" maple or apple grilling plank
At least 1 hour before grilling, soak plank in enough
water to cover. Place a weight on plank so it stays
submerged during soaking.
In a small bowl combine goat cheese, basil, thyme, chives,
and pepper. Form the mixture into a mound and coat evenly
with oil; set aside.
For a charcoal or gas grill, grease grill rack. Place
plank on the rack of an uncovered grill directly over
medium heat until plank begins to crackle and smoke.
Meanwhile, place peaches, cut sides down, on grill rack.
Grill about 3 minutes or until grill marks appear. Place
peaches on the plank; add goat cheese mound and nuts.
Cover; grill for 15 to 20 minutes or until peaches are
softened and golden.
Transfer plank with peaches, goat cheese, and nuts to a
serving platter. Cut peaches into wedges. Drizzle goat
cheese with honey. Serve with crackers.
